본문 바로가기

blueprint2

[Unreal Engine] 블루프린트와 나이아가라 알아보기 안녕하세요. 정글러입니다. 오늘은 언리얼엔진의 블루프린트와 나이아가라를 알아보고자 합니다.- 블루프린트는 오브젝트에 기능을 추가하거나 상태를 변화시킬 수 있는 언리얼엔진의 비주얼 스크립팅 언어입니다. - 나이아가라는 방송, 영상에서 사용 가능한 고퀄리티 이펙트 제작이 가능한 언리얼엔진의 새로운 파티클 시스템 입니다.1. 블루프린트먼저 블루프린트는 노드 기반의 프로그래밍 언어인데요,비주얼 스크립팅으로 텍스트 기반의 코드가 아니라 노드를 연결하는 방식으로 원하는 기능을 구현하는 스크립팅 방법입니다. 블루프린트에서 변경하고 싶은 스태틱매시를 선택하고 불러옵니다.이후 레벨에서 콘텐츠 브라우저에서 변경할 BP를 선택한 뒤에 변경해야 하는 에셋을 선택하여 선택된 액터를 다음으로 대체를 눌러줍니다. 블루프린트의 이벤.. 2024. 6. 3.
[Unreal Engine] Player Controller 블루프린트 이해하기/ 시작해요 언리얼2024 등록 안녕하세요. 정글러입니다. 오늘은 언리얼 엔진의 블루프린트에서 Player Controller의 기본에 대해 알아보고자 합니다.먼저 Character의 블루프린트에서는 Space Bar에서 jump함수가 바로 연결가능합니다.하지만 Player Controller의 블루프린트에서는 Character의 블루프린트와는 다르게 점프 함수에 바로 접근할 수 없습니다.따라서 Get Player Character 함수를 통해 player에게 접근해야 합니다. 1) Space Bar- Get Player Character-JumpGet Player Character 함수는 지정된 플레이어가 사용하는 문자를 반환합니다.따라서 Return Value에서 Jump함수를 연결해주고, space bar의 Pressed와 연결해.. 2024. 4. 29.